Eilid lives on an island. Adrift and with one eye on the horizon, she is aimless. It seems every day someone is leaving for the mainland, even her own mother.
And then a whale washes up on the shore, followed soon after by a mysterious young girl…
Using loop pedal technology, two actors will bring an entire town to life. Community meetings smash against mythology as two friends from different worlds learn how an ancient fracture can lead to a new future, together.
Hailing from Scotland, and recontextualised by ATYP, this worldwide smash-hit washes up to Pier 2/3 and takes over The Popsy.

Hayden Tonazzi
Director
Director


Hayden Tonazzi
(
they/he
)
is an award-winning director and creative producer who in 2025 was appointed the Artistic Director & CEO of the Australian Theatre for Young People (ATYP). A graduate of the 2019 NIDA MFA Directing Program, for over eight years they have worked across new writing in theatre and musical theatre.


Miranda Middleton
Co-Director & Choreographer
Co-Director & Choreographer


Miranda Middleton
(
she/her
)
Director, writer and choreographer with an MFA (Directing) from NIDA. In 2024, she received the Sandra Bates Director’s Award at Ensemble Theatre and was nominated for a Green Room Award for Outstanding Direction of an Independent Musical for The Grinning Man. Recent work includes Bright Star, Into the Woods, In Her Own Words, The Grinning Man and The Eisteddfod, with assistant directing credits across Opera Australia, MTC and Ensemble Theatre.


Madeleine Picard
Sound Designer
Sound Designer


Madeleine Picard
(
she/her
)
is a sound designer and composer working on Gadigal land. Recent credits: Dial M for Murder, Emerald City (Ensemble), Life is a Dream, Hot Tub, Shitty (Belvoir 25A), Amber, All the Fraudulent Horse Girls (Old Fitz), Scab (ATYP) and The Weekend (Belvoir). As associate sound designer or realiser: The Talented Mr Ripley, Julia, Whitefella Yella Tree, The Wrong Gods, Song of First Desire and Ride the Cyclone across STC, Griffin, Belvoir and Hayes.


Aden Abeleda
Associate Director & Producer
Associate Director & Producer


Aden Abeleda
(
he/him
)
Director and producer with a BA in Arts Industries and Management from Macquarie University. He is a co-founder of Ignite Theatre Company, directing and producing Carrie: The Musical and Monty Python’s Spamalot, and co-directing Definitely Not a Hungry Game: A Parody Musical at the Eternity Playhouse for Sydney Fringe. Recent production roles with Kermond Creative, Packemin, and Hayes Theatre Co with Associate Producer of the Festival of New Work


Gabriel Faatau'uu-Satiu
Creative Cultural Consultant
Creative Cultural Consultant


Gabriel Faatau'uu-Satiu
(
he/him
)
Sāmoan Tusitala and People Weaver, and founder of Satiu Studios, a Pasifika-led production company amplifying Pacific voices. Won Best Emerging Producer at Sydney Fringe and the NSWCPC Pasifika Awards Art Open category. He consulted for NSW Waratahs’ Pacific Round, produced Across the Pacific with QTOPIA, co-led the Aus premiere of Tinā, and secured Screen Australia funding for 2 Moons, commissioned by Powerhouse Museum.


Victoria Falconer-Pritchard
Industry Mentor
Industry Mentor


Victoria Falconer-Pritchard
(
she/her
)
is a performer, music director, multi-instrumentalist and writer of Filipino-English heritage, and Co-Artistic Director of Hayes Theatre Co. Her work spans cabaret, theatre and cross-disciplinary performance, with credits including Smashed: The Nightcap, The Sight, The Vali Myers Project and Smashed: The Brunch Party. A 40 Under 40 Asian-Australian awardee, she is also a founding member of The People of Cabaret.
